Output 84c104fd8d42882b2561c41fe44df75c36bf1e78ce1e8c96f939d94046a5256c:35

value
53804
script pubkey
OP_0 OP_PUSHBYTES_20 c44c913f2bab21cef53cad64d25dbce345c923b7
address
bc1qc3xfz0et4vsuaafu44jdyhduudzujgahq2um5u
transaction
84c104fd8d42882b2561c41fe44df75c36bf1e78ce1e8c96f939d94046a5256c
spent
true